What counts as public infrastructure?

Public infrastructure includes the physical systems and services that keep society running — everything from the roads we drive on to the power that lights our homes. 

Government agencies typically fund, operate, and regulate these systems to serve the public good. They play a vital role in safety, mobility, health, and economic productivity.

A white bus travels down a street with people walking on the sidewalk beside it

Core categories of public infrastructure

Transportation infrastructure

This includes highways, local roads, bridges, tunnels, railways, ports, and airports. These systems are critical for moving people, goods, and emergency services efficiently and safely.

Utility and energy infrastructure

Utilities form the backbone of modern living. Public power distribution services, which refer to the systems that deliver electricity from the grid to homes, businesses, and public facilities, are also key components. These include water supply systems, sewage treatment plants, and stormwater infrastructure.

Communication networks

This includes broadband internet, telecom towers, and other digital infrastructure that support communication, remote work, emergency services, and digital equity.

Social infrastructure

Though less visible, public buildings such as schools, hospitals, fire stations, and courthouses are also essential, as they provide vital services. Their safety and reliability are part of the broader public infrastructure conversation.

The current state of the U.S. infrastructure

The overall state of America’s public infrastructure has improved slightly, but it remains fragile. The latest ASCE “Infrastructure Report Card” raised the national grade to C, up from a C‑ in 2021. While this is the highest rating since ASCE began grading in 1998, it reflects gradual progress rather than a full turnaround.

Several key infrastructure categories are still struggling:

  • Roads, energy systems, and transit continue to earn low marks, with several falling into the D range.
  • Core services like drinking water and stormwater systems also languish poorly, with grades like C‑ or D+.
  • Flood-prone and climate-vulnerable infrastructure remains a major public safety risk.

The federal government has rolled out historic funding to address these issues through laws like the Infrastructure Investment and Jobs Act (IIJA), providing hundreds of billions to modernize roads, bridges, broadband, and public infrastructure solutions. Still, estimates show a massive $3.7 trillion gap remains in funding over the next decade.

Vulnerabilities to outages, wildfires, and cyber threats

In many areas, outdated equipment and exposed transmission lines increase the risk of wildfires, especially during dry, windy conditions. California’s devastating wildfires in recent years are a clear example of what happens when electric infrastructure isn’t maintained or modernized.

Meanwhile, power grids are also a growing target for cyberattacks. As systems become more digitally connected, they also become more exposed to malicious actors. 

Without modern cybersecurity infrastructure and response capabilities, entire regions can be left without power, creating ripple effects across emergency services, healthcare, transportation, and communications.

Weather and energy system impacts

Severe weather events are occurring more frequently and hitting harder. 

  • Extreme heatwaves strain electric grids during peak demand. 
  • Flooding damages underground utility lines and erodes roads. 
  • Winter storms have the potential to freeze equipment and trigger mass outages. 

As the climate changes, public infrastructure solutions must be designed to withstand these unpredictable conditions.

Modernized systems — like smart grids, reinforced transmission structures, and weather-resistant materials — could reduce outage risks and help utilities respond more quickly when disasters strike.

Blackouts, equipment failures, and grid instability

Old infrastructure leads to frequent blackouts and equipment failures, affecting urban and rural communities. Electrical transformers, switches, and substations operate well beyond their intended lifespan in many cities. Without updates, they are more likely to fail during peak usage or a minor surge in demand.

These breakdowns disrupt businesses, schools, hospitals, and public safety systems. Widespread outages reduce productivity, damage equipment, and cost billions in recovery efforts each year. 

We need strategic investments in public power distribution services to keep pace with growing energy demand and support a more reliable and flexible grid.

Road and bridge safety risks

On the transportation side, roads and bridges are visibly deteriorating in many areas. Potholes, cracking pavement, and structural weaknesses lead to accidents, higher vehicle maintenance costs, and travel delays. 

ASCE shows over 40% of U.S. roads are in poor or mediocre condition, and more than 46,000 bridges are considered structurally deficient.

These weaknesses are dangerous. A single failure may result in injury or loss of life, and many of these risks are preventable through proactive inspection and timely upgrades.

Funding, policy, and the path forward

Modernizing America’s public infrastructure requires strong public policy, strategic planning, and long-term investment. Maintenance and upgrades have been delayed for decades due to budget constraints, political gridlock, and competing priorities. But the conversation has shifted in recent years, and real progress is underway.

Historic federal funding: A step in the right direction

The Infrastructure Investment and Jobs Act (IIJA), signed into law in 2021, allocated over $1.2 trillion to infrastructure projects across the United States. This includes significant investments in roads, bridges, railways, clean water, high-speed internet, and public power distribution services. 

For many communities, this funding presents a once-in-a-generation opportunity to rebuild with resilience in mind.

Alongside federal dollars, states and municipalities are being encouraged to create long-term infrastructure plans, prioritize risk-prone assets, and embrace sustainable construction methods. This has opened the door for more public infrastructure solutions that combine safety, climate readiness, and smart technology.

The challenge of long-term planning and prioritization

While the funding is significant, the reality is that America’s infrastructure backlog is enormous. With thousands of aging bridges, roads in disrepair, outdated electrical grids, and water systems nearing the end of their service life, deciding where to start is a challenge.

Infrastructure policy must support data-driven planning to identify and prioritize at-risk systems, streamlined permitting processes to reduce delays, and resilient design standards that factor in climate change, population growth, and evolving energy needs.

Additionally, public agencies must ensure that funding reaches underserved and rural communities that often face the most urgent infrastructure gaps.

The role of the private sector and public-private partnerships

Infrastructure companies are stepping up with innovative, scalable solutions that help local governments get the most value from their investments. Through public-private partnerships (P3s), private firms can contribute design, construction, and long-term operations expertise while sharing financial risk.

These partnerships are especially useful in delivering complex public infrastructure solutions — like smart grids, energy storage systems, and sustainable transportation upgrades — faster and more affordably than traditional procurement methods allow.
